As a retired maternity nurse, I don't believe in "nipple confusion" from bottles or soothers. I *do* however, believe in "flow confusion." Make sure whatever bottle you get has a very slow flow. A baby that gets used to even a little more fast flow from a bottle can get lazy and frustrated at the breast to the point of refusal.
